1. The Early Days of Plumbing

To understand the evolution of toilet tank washers, we must first look at the history of plumbing. The origins of plumbing can be traced back to ancient civilizations such as the Romans, Greeks, and Egyptians who devised rudimentary systems for waste removal and water supply. However, the modern toilet as we know it today began to take shape in the late 19th century.

In the 1880s, toilet designs began to incorporate flushing mechanisms, putting a system in place where a tank stored water that could be released on demand. These early toilets often featured basic rubber gaskets or homemade solutions that would eventually lead to leaks and inefficiencies, resulting in the need for a more effective sealing system.

2. The Introduction of Rubber Washers

By the turn of the century, the material science behind washers had improved, leading to the introduction of rubber washers. Rubber, known for its flexibility and resistance to water, became a favored choice for sealing connections in toilet tanks. Manufacturers began producing standardized rubber washers that provided a more reliable seal than their predecessors.

This innovation dramatically reduced water leaks, and toilet manufacturers started creating specific designs that included rubber washers in the tank and flush mechanisms. Rubber washers laid the groundwork for further developments in toilet tank technology, offering homeowners peace of mind and a better user experience.

3. Advancements in Materials: PVC and Silicone

As the 20th century progressed, advancements in material science led to the introduction of new materials, notably PVC (polyvinyl chloride) and silicone. These materials did not only enhance the durability of washers but also their resistance to chemicals commonly found in household cleaners.

Silicone washers, in particular, became prominent for their ability to withstand high-pressure conditions, temperature fluctuations, and chemical exposure. Homeowners began to appreciate the longevity of silicone over rubber, which often degraded faster under similar conditions.

Modern toilets began to incorporate a variety of washers made from these advanced materials, which complemented the increasing complexity of toilet design, including dual flush systems and water-saving mechanisms that required even more precise sealing solutions.

FAQs

1. What is the main role of a toilet tank washer?

The main role of a toilet tank washer is to create a watertight seal between the tank and the flush mechanism to prevent leaks and ensure optimal flushing performance.

2. How often should toilet tank washers be replaced?

It is advisable to check and potentially replace toilet tank washers every few years or whenever you notice signs of leaks or poor flushing performance. Regular maintenance can prevent costly water bills and damage.

3. Can I replace a washer with a different material?

While you can replace a washer with a different material, it’s crucial to choose a washer that is compatible with your toilet type and the condition of the flushing mechanism. Always consult product specifications or a plumbing professional if you’re unsure.

4. What are the signs that a toilet tank washer is failing?

Signs include visible leaks around the tank, poor flushing performance, and an irregular fill cycle. If the toilet runs continuously, this could also indicate a failing washer.

5. Are there eco-friendly options for toilet tank washers?

Yes, many manufacturers now offer eco-friendly washers made from biodegradable materials or recycled plastics, reflecting a growing focus on sustainability in home plumbing products.
